1. Understanding Alopecia and its Impact
First and foremost, it's important to grasp what alopecia is and its potential effects on individuals. Alopecia is an autoimmune disease that causes hair loss, ranging from small patches to complete baldness. The psychological impact of this condition can be profound, impacting self-esteem and overall well-being. By understanding the condition, individuals can better navigate their own experiences and seek the support they need.
Personal Story: Jada's Initial Struggles
Jada Pinkett Smith experienced her first encounter with alopecia in her 20s when she noticed small bald patches on her scalp. This sudden hair loss caused her feelings of insecurity, and she struggled to find ways to cope and maintain her self-confidence.

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Qs)
-
Q: Will my hair ever grow back if I have alopecia?
A: The regrowth of hair in alopecia varies from individual to individual. While there is no definitive cure for the condition, some treatments and therapies may help stimulate hair regrowth in certain cases. It is best to consult with a healthcare professional to discuss personalized treatment options.
-
Q: Can stress worsen alopecia symptoms?
A: Stress is known to have an impact on various health conditions, including alopecia. While stress alone may not directly cause the condition, it can contribute to its worsening or trigger flare-ups. Managing stress through relaxation techniques, counseling, or other coping strategies may help in mitigating alopecia symptoms.
